The Walpole Fire Department has its primary responsibility to the citizens of Walpole. Walpole is 20 square miles in area, with a population of approximately 23,000. Protecting $1.7 billion dollars worth of property.
The Fire Department operates 24 hrs a day, 7 days a week with its 30 Full time Firefighters, Paramedics, and Chief Officers with Full time Advanced Life Support EMS and fire prevention/suppression staff from our 1 station.
With 4 Engines, 1 Ladder Truck, 2 Ambulances, 2 Small Brush Trucks, 1 Large Brush Truck, 1 Special Hazards Unit,and with Support and utility vehicles the department handles the wide veriety of needs for the town.
